f you want to shop 'til you drop, then you're in luck.
Sure, you could wander aimlessly around Bristol for hours on end looking for pretty shiny things to spend your money on, but why bother when you can let us do the searching for you? If it's a market you're looking for, then ye olde St Nicholas Market (Corn Street, 0117 922 4014) will do the job. A browser's paradise, there are secondhand stores, trinkets, treasures, tat and even a stall where you can pick up some pie and mash. For sheer randomness, IOTA (83 Gloucester Road, 0117 924 4911) will keep you busy, selling jewellery, weird birthday presents and little bits and bobs to make your room look nice. Finally, for clothes, forget Topshop. Instead, check out the awesome Repsycho Retro Superstore (85 Gloucester Road, 0117 983 0007), where you can pick up some old clobber and finally get that Frank Sinatra look/sequined thong/funky pair of sunglasses.
Top five bits of tourist tat you can buy in Bristol
Umbrella - Barely a day passes without rain in the West Country. Yes, even in August.
Keg of exhibition cider - Just two pints can kill, so be careful...
Model of SS Great Britain - Boats are way cooler than bridges.
'Gert Lush' T-shirt - Show your loyalty to Brizzle. Mint, innit?
Pie Minister pie - Edible souvenirs will be big this year.
Top five shops to bag a bargain in
Freak Boutique - Fab vintage at equally old-fashioned prices.
BS8 - A quick fix for all those 'I've got absolutely nothing to wear' emergency situations.
St Nicholas Market - An Aladdin's cave of the weird and wonderful.
Motel - Quirky clothes that won't break the bank.
Billie Jean Clothes - Make the man in the mirror smile back.
